Tokyo Electron US is seeking a Business Intelligence Engineer Intern for Summer 2026. In this role, you will work with a cross-functional team to gain practical experience in business intelligence and analysis while contributing to data development and optimization tasks.

Since its founding in 1963, TEL has grown to encompass many offices around the world that engineer, manufacture, sell, and service wafer-processing or semiconductor production equipment (SPE), as well as flat panel display (FPD) and thin-film silicon photovoltaic equipment (PVE).
